2. Obito Uchiha

This story begins when Obito and Kakashi infiltrate the enemy’s stronghold, a stone dome, with the mission to rescue Rin, who was being held hostage by Iwagakure Shinobi. Upon their arrival, they were immediately confronted by Kakko, leading to an intense two-against-one battle. Kakashi managed to slash Kakko’s shoulder with his sword, causing Kakko to collapse to the ground. Kakashi believed the enemy had been defeated.

Without wasting any time, Kakashi and Obito hurried to free Rin from the Genjutsu and untie the ropes that bound her. However, as they were focused on rescuing Rin, Kakko got back up. He used a Jutsu to destroy his own base, causing large stones to fall as the structure began to collapse.

Kakashi immediately ordered Obito and Rin to run to safety. However, during their escape, a large boulder fell and struck Kakashi on the head, causing him to fall. Without hesitation, Obito ran back to help Kakashi. He pushed Kakashi out of harm’s way, but tragically, a massive boulder fell and crushed half of Obito’s body.

Following this incident, Obito was presumed dead and was honored as a hero of Konoha. However, the truth was different. Obito was saved by Madara Uchiha, though he lost his right hand as a consequence of the event.
